Crystal Fantasy
"I never travel without my diary, one should always have something sensational to
read . . .” Oscar Wilde, 1891
April 12, 2011
It happened again on April 12th
My crystal dove fell off the shelf
The shelf of knickknacks in my mind
Of people and places, left behind
This one was Adam and all we could be
Lovers, partners, the possibilities
The alternate dream, if you would
Of another us in a parallel world
Where I’m not married, nor is he
And dreams of together morph into being
I pick this dove up, this Adam fantasy
And place it on the shelf, out of my reach
Susan Burch
